About BURKE & HERBERT FINANCIAL SE

Burke & Herbert Financial Services Corp. operates as a bank holding company, offering a comprehensive range of banking products and financial solutions. Its client base includes small to medium-sized businesses, along with their owners and employees, professional corporations, non-profit organizations, and individual customers. The company organizes its lending operations into several distinct portfolio segments: Commercial Real Estate: This segment's loans are evaluated based on the income generated from leasing the underlying property or its potential proceeds upon sale. Owner-Occupied Commercial Real Estate: Here, the focus is on the operational strength of the business occupying the property, in addition to the collateral's value. Acquisition, Construction, and Development: Loans in this category are contingent on the borrower's credit standing, the project's adherence to budget and timely completion, the prospects of a successful sale post-development, and the value of the collateral. Commercial and Industrial: Lending in this segment emphasizes the financial health of the borrowing business and the worth of its collateral. Single Family Residential (1-4 Units): These loans, often for investment purposes, consider the borrower's continued creditworthiness, the market value of the collateral, and either the net rental income generated or the proceeds from the property's sale. Consumer Non-Real Estate and Other: This segment covers loans where risk assessment primarily involves the borrower's credit reliability and the value of the collateral provided. Burke & Herbert Financial Services Corp. was established on September 14, 2022, and is headquartered in Alexandria, Virginia.
